Giuseppe Camerata

Summary

Giuseppe Camerata is a human[1]. He was born in Venice[2]. He was born on January 1, 1718[3]. He passed away in Dresden[4]. He died on March 14, 1793[5]. He worked as a painter[6], printmaker[7], and illuminator[8]. He 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(2 views/month, #7,300 of 1,000,298).[9]
